阿里巴巴电子商务案例分析B to B:环球资源网,万国商业网,慧聪网,太平洋门户网,中国制造网B to C:京东商城,当当网,亚马逊,VANCL(凡客诚品)C to C:淘宝网,易趣,腾讯拍拍C to B:豆瓣网,摇篮网,宝宝树问:阿里巴巴属于哪一类型?一、阿里巴巴集团简介及企业文化(一)阿里巴巴简介企业全称:阿里巴巴集团企业简称:阿里巴巴英文名称:Alibaba Group阿里巴巴集团成立于1999年,英语教师马云与另外17人在中国杭州市创办了阿里巴巴网站,为中小型制造商提供了一个销售产品的贸易平台。
经过8年的发展,阿里巴巴于2007年11月6日在香港联合交易所上市,现为阿里巴巴集团的旗舰业务。
“让天下没有难做的生意”是阿里巴巴集团永恒的使命,培育开放、协同、繁荣的电子商务生态圈,是阿里巴巴集团的战略目标。
马云阿里巴巴集团主席及首席执行官阿里巴巴集团经营多元化的互联网业务,包括促进B2B国际和中国国内贸易的网上交易市场、网上零售和支付平台、网上购物搜索引擎,以及以数据为中心的云计算服务,致力为全球所有人创造便捷的网上交易渠道。
阿里巴巴集团由中国互联网先锋马云于1999年创立,他希望将互联网发展成为普及使用、安全可靠的工具,让大众受惠。
阿里巴巴集团由私人持股,现服务来自超过240个国家和地区的互联网用户。
阿里巴巴集团及其关联公司在大中华地区、印度、日本、韩国、英国及美国70多个城市共有25,000多名员工。
成立时间: 1999年3月10日由中国互联网商业先驱成立,以杭州为研究发展基地,9月10日在香港设立国际总部。

淘宝国际版跨境电商成功案例分享近年来,跨境电商行业飞速发展,淘宝国际版作为中国最大的跨境电商平台之一,推动了中国企业向全球市场扩展业务的趋势。
本文将分享一个淘宝国际版跨境电商成功案例,分享一家化妆品企业如何通过淘宝国际版拓展海外市场并取得成果。
1.背景介绍该化妆品企业名为"XX品牌",成立于2010年,以生产和销售高品质化妆品为主,其产品系列包括护肤品、彩妆等。
虽然该企业在国内市场上的销售表现优异,但由于中国市场的竞争日益激烈,企业为了实现持续增长,在2015年开始启动了海外拓展计划。
然而,由于缺少海外销售经验、文化差异等问题,企业最初的国际业务拓展并不理想。
2. 淘宝国际版的拓展2017年,该企业开始接触淘宝国际版平台,并逐渐了解和熟悉了跨境电商平台的销售方式和各项规则。
在认证之后,该企业在淘宝国际版平台上开设了自己的官方旗舰店。
由于平台的知名度和用户量,以及该企业过硬的产品品质,刚开始在淘宝国际版上的销售表现令人满意。
到2018年底,该企业已在俄罗斯、英国、美国、德国等多个国家建立了销售网络,海外销售已经成为该企业增长的主要引擎。
3. 成功的原因①产品质量可靠。
对于化妆品而言,产品的安全性和品质是最为重要的衡量标准,该企业有自己的生产基地和团队,也有自己的实验室检测设备。
因此,该企业得以保证产品质量,而淘宝国际版平台也通过品质认证等手段保障消费者的消费安全,这是该企业能够赢得消费者信任的重要因素。
②精准的产品定位。
该企业的产品以中高端市场为主,针对中高收入、具有一定消费意愿的人群,通过淘宝国际版平台精准投放广告和活动,满足了这部分海外消费者的需求。
同时,该企业不断更新和推出新品,既保持了消费者的兴趣,又增加了销售额。
③完善的售后服务。
因为涉及到跨国运输,运输过程中难免会发生一些损坏或者缺货等情况,但该企业进行了及时的沟通和处理,保证了消费者的利益,并在整个售后过程中给予了很好的用户体验。

电子商务淘宝英文分析TaobaoAfter learning the International Business Practice . I had search for some famous e-commerce websites in China , such as taobao , 360buy , joyo Amazon and so on . And what I want to talk about a commercial , e-commerce website is taobao , the most largest shopping website which is called the Chinese electronic harbor in Asian .Taobao’s development:Taobao now is the largest retail network business circle in the asia-pacific region . It was established by alibaba in May 10 , 2003 . At that time online shopping is a new thing in China . But one of the largest American E-commerce company eBay have already came into this big market , at that time eBay had more than 90% of the e-commerce Market share in China . So when alibaba declared to establish taobao , no one think it would last for a long time . But what taobao did was not to battle for the market share eBay already had . On the contrary , it put its eye on the grow marketing . Actually in the first two years , the volumn in taobao is very little compare wi th todays’ . According to the survey , taobao was not on the Internet laboratory e-commerce sites CISI popularity list before 2004 . But with the development of technology and the living standard of people is higher , taobao’s business was at the rate of 768% growth in the coming 3 years . So taobao used just one year to become the largest Chinese e-commerce company from 2004 .In 2005 taobao firstly beyond eBay and became the largest e-commerce company in China . T aobao became the largest shopping website in Asian . At the same time the number ofChinese Internet users grew to 100 million . More and more people have their own computer and most of them are those who are working in big city and didn’t have too much time go shopping . Taobao gave them a good place to buy what they want to buy and whenever and wherever they want to buy somthing. They are the most important reason for the increase of Taobao’s business. As time goes on , taobao has make it possible that Internet is not only a tool , but also a way of live . According to the survey , everyday there are more than 9 million people go to taobao . By the year of 2007 , taobao is no longer a auction website , but the largest network retail business circle . In this year the total volume of taobao is 40 billion . Goods on the Internet for present mass , good and inexpensive and other characteristics , shopping on the Internet gradually become the habits of mainstream consumer .Taobao’s revenue stream:When it comes to taobao’s revenu e stream , advertising revenue may be one of the most important part of it’s income . Actually we know that at the first few years , taobao could not earn enough money , because it is free for many things . So Alibaba had to put much money in it until taobao declared that it would start it’s network advertising business . Now taobaohad already launched many kinds of advertising , such as banner ads and those hit ads . This is the first profit model that taobao official declared . It is the d evelopment of it’s volumn a day and large number of users that lead to this . Taobao’s official said in this way they can focus on using their own distinct advantage to give their guests accurate and efficient services , such as help their guests to impove their brand and help them to promote their sales . At the same time , taobao also launched some value-added service plan to its advertisers . It contains brand promotion , market research , consumer research and community activities . The way it help its consumers to promote their sales it to develop the network marketing channel .Taobao also have some other revenue streams . Competitive ranking is one of them .Competitive ranking means that if the shop owner pays for taobao , the shop’s products will be put in front when the consumer search for this kind of product otherwise their products will be put in bottom . Many people objected to this idea . They said taobao had break its own word that it would not launched this kind of service and this is another kind to get money from those shop owner . Some of them also said this service may them hard to keep their shop and if taobao continued to do that , they would rather open a shop in other website instead of taobao . And in my opinion , I don’t think this is a good way for taobao to offer this kind of service .Somethind about Alipay:Maybe in most people’s eyes , taobao doesn’t have a lot of ways to increase its income . And actually it is . But we have to know that the most important way taobao get its income is not on taobao website itself . It is the Alipay . We all know bothtaobao and Alipay belong to Alibaba . So though what I talk about is taobao , I have to talk something about Alipay . Alipay is the domestic advanced online payment platform, which is founded by the global best B2B company alibaba , it offers high-quality security payment services for network business . Alipay first launched on October 18, 2003 , and it became an indispensable online trading payment in one year , it is fond by most members of taobao . Alipay is a pioneering work of Internet enterprise service , it is a milestone of electronic commerce .Alipay is the third party pay in China . Alipay account system was established at December 10 , 2004 . In my mind Alipay is just like a bank , sometimes it is more than a bank . According to survey , the total volumn of taobao in one year have already beyond that of Chinese wal-mart , what’s more , almost 98% trading in taobao use Alipay . Both of buyers and sellers need to storage their money in the Aliplay if they want to trade in taobao . When people buy something in taobao , the money they pay will be put on Alipay until the product is received by the buyers . During this time the company can use this money to invest whatever they want . The volumn in taobao a day is more than 800 million . This means that everyday 800 million will be storaged in Alipay for at least 3 days . BUSINESS IN SECOND LIFEIn 2003,a 3-D vitual world called Second Life(SL)was opened to the public.The world is entirely built and owned by its resident. In 2003,the virtual world consisted of 64 acres. By 2010it had grown to over 100000 acresand was inhabited by millions of residents from around the planet(see ).The virtual world consists of ahuge digital contient,island,people,enterainment,experiences,and opportunities. Thousands of new residents join each day and creat their own avatats through which they travel around the SL world meeting people,communicating,having fun,and buying virtual land and other virtual properties where they can open a business or build a personal space, limited only by their imaginations and their ability To use the virtual 3-D applications.Avatars have unique names and move around in imaginative vehicles including helicopers, submarines, and hot-air balloons. Rsaidents get some free virtual land (and they can buy more)where they build a house, a city, or a business.They can then sell the virtrual properties or the virtual products or servives they create.Residents can also sell real-world products or services.For example,Copeland and Kelleher(2007)report that more than 25000 aspiring entrepreneurs trade virtual products or services at SL. Virtual goods entrepreneurs,landowners,in-world builders, and service providers generated user-to-user transactions totaling US$350 million in 2008(Linder 2009).Stevan Lieberman, an attorney, is one of these people .He uses his expertise in intellectual property and the site to solcit work-mainly from programmers who are looking to patient their code. SL is manage by Linden Labs, which provides Linden dollars that can be converted to U.S dollars.SL uses several Web 2.0 tools such as blogs, wikis,RSS,and tags (from ).Virtual businesses succeed due to the onwers’ingenuity,artistic ability, entrepreneurial expertise, and reputation.Many organizations use SL from 3-D persentations of their products. Even goverment s open viatual embassies on “Diplomacy Island,” localed on the site. Many univer-sities offer educational courses and seminars in virtual classrooms(see “EduIslands” on the SL site and Appendix A in Rymaszewski,et al.[2008]).Roush (2007) describes how to combine SL with Google Earth.Such combinations enable investigation of phenomena that would otherwise be difficult to visualize or understand .
